Mumbai: Punjabi singer-songwriter Harrdy Sandhu has dropped his latest pop single, ‘Ki Haal Aa’, which he says is an ode to the celebratory spirit of Punjabi culture, crafted with a sound that connects with audiences around the world.
The upbeat number combines energetic rhythms, infectious melodies, and Harrdy’s signature powerhouse vocals to create a track that celebrates the vibrancy of modern Punjabi music.
Speaking about the song, Harrdy said, “With ‘Ki Haal Aa,’ I wanted to capture the festive essence of Punjabi culture while creating a sound that resonates globally. The melodies are upbeat and full of life — designed to make everyone dance and celebrate.”
Blending traditional Punjabi elements with contemporary pop sounds, ‘Ki Haal Aa’ brings together catchy hooks and pulsating beats. Its visually striking music video adds to the song’s high-energy vibe, featuring dazzling visuals that mirror its celebratory mood.
Harrdy Sandhu began his musical journey with Tequilla Shot and rose to fame with hits like Soch and Joker. His track Soch was later recreated for Akshay Kumar’s 2016 film Airlift, while Naah was reimagined as Naah Goriye for the movie Bala.
Expanding his horizons, Harrdy made his Hindi film debut in 83 (2021) alongside Ranveer Singh, portraying a key role in the cricket drama based on India’s 1983 World Cup victory. He was last seen in the 2022 spy thriller Code Name: Tiranga, co-starring Parineeti Chopra and Sharad Kelkar, where he played an agent on a high-stakes mission across the Middle East.
